Acosta Director of Security Salaries in Albany, NY

The average Acosta Director of Security in Albany, NY earns an estimated $151,758 annually. Acosta's Director of Security compensation is $5,999 less than the US average for a Director of Security.

In Albany, NY, The IT Department at Acosta earns $18,504 more on average than the Finance Department.
